The
Citadel's School of Education is housed in Capers Hall.
Built in 1951, Capers Hall is home to offices,
classrooms and other areas for Education, English, History,
Modern Languages, Political Science and Psychology.
The building is named in honor of brothers, Brigadier
General Ellison Capers, C.S.A., Citadel 1857, and Major Francis
W. Capers, Superintendent of The Citadel from 1852-1859.
The south wing of Capers Hall is a 1978 addition
dedicated to the memory of Mr. Rodney Williams at the request
of his wife.
